Laura is still waiting for Prince Charming at the age of 24. So when Sandro appears at a party exactly like her Prince would in her dreams she thinks she's finally found her knight in shining armour. But then when she meets Maxime the following night Laura starts to wonder if some Princes could be more charming than others. Will everything end happily ever after for Laura? Or will the prince turn out to be the frog? A sharp snappy and wonderfully droll comedy of manners and errors this charming French romantic drama has won over legions of admirers across the... channel and is now poised to set hearts aflutter in Britain too. Bittersweet French comedy drama co-written, directed by and starring Agnès Jaoui. A modern smorgasbord of classic fairytale tropes, the film follows a number of characters who are having trouble dealing with the complexities of life. Laura (Agathe Bonitzer), who dreams of meeting her Prince Charming, must make a choice between two men when she meets Sandro (Arthur Dupont), an aspiring composer, and Maxime (Benjamin Biolay), a notorious womaniser and music critic. Meanwhile, Sandro's father Pierre (Jean-Pierre Bacri) has difficulty making plans when he is reminded of his impending death by a mysterious clairvoyant.
